Abstract :
The higher speed exhibited by the current-feedback opamp, compared to conventional architectures, is mainly due to the superior slew-rate, whereas the constant closed-loop bandwidth relies on a low input resistance value. This last requirement was revealed as the principal obstacle to the development of efficient CMOS implementations. A high-performance and robust CMOS current-feedback operational amplifier is proposed in this paper. It is obtained through a feedback configuration, which provides low input resistance and, working in class AB, allows high slew-rate capability. A design using a 0.35-μm process is given and SPICE simulations confirming the overall good performance are also provided.
